Foreign direct investment inflows in Ecuador in 2025 — 1,299,231,390 US$. Ranked 53 in the world out of 97. Since 1970, the indicator has risen by 1,366.4%.

Net inflows of foreign direct investment — investment by non-residents that gives them at least 10% of the voting shares of an enterprise: equity capital, reinvested earnings and intra-company loans. Values can be negative when capital is withdrawn. The figures are distorted by flows in transit through holding-company jurisdictions.
Source: UNCTADstat (UNCTAD), license CC BY 3.0 IGO.
